Transaction 22891589bde31fdd5ddbde51d2d988c97a19e554fc9876a9fb985bd5c43bc0b0
1 Input
1 Output
-
22891589bde31fdd5ddbde51d2d988c97a19e554fc9876a9fb985bd5c43bc0b0:0
- value
- 695820
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ea0a36042ba48959782cd2be2b4b157e51416a1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19dLxNQKxw65ckAtFJQv4dWWMVwh5nB2VR